Kenickie was a punk-indie band from Sunderland, England that formed in 1994 at the height of the Britpop era. Championed by the British DJ John Peel, two of their singles were voted into the Festive Fifty of 1996, with "Punka" coming in at number 4, and "Come Out 2Nite" being placed at number 1. 1997 saw three UK Top 40 chart singles ("In Your Car", "Nightlife" and a re-release of "Punka") and their debut album, "At The Club", made the UK Top 10.
